Quench your need for speed in Breakneck by PikPok, now available for download

PikPok has done it again. They have released an extremely polished, fun and fast game to play. This title is quite different from Into the Dead, Flick Kick Football, or Rival Stars Basketball. Breakneck, their latest title available in the Google Play Store, is all about speed. The game has great controls, amazing graphics and a difficulty level that you shouldn’t shy away from. Rescue your beloved in this Dark Eye adventure game called Skilltree Saga, now on Google Play

Released by Headup Games, Skilltree Saga is a casual RPG that’s now available for Android. The game is set in the Dark Eye universe, specifically on the continent of Aventuria. Players will begin their story with the city of Griffonford being besieged by Sargul and his army of goblins and orks. To compound matters, the the daughter of Baron Griffontrue (your romantic interest) has been abducted, and you will need to take up pursuit in an effort to rescue her.

Electronic Arts launches their own eSports league called the Competitive Gaming Division

eSports has been growing since its inception, and will continue to grow for some time to come as well. In fact the mobile eSports leagues are just starting to really materialize and will most likely grow to be as big as PC/console eSports leagues. Today eSport just got a little bigger with the announcement of EA’s own eSports initiative called their Competitive Gaming Division.

The Vainglory EU Autumn finals Day 1 has begun. You can watch it all live too.

The North American Autumn finals for the rather popular mobile MOBA title Vainglory took place last weekend, with a prize pool for the season of over $200,000 up for grabs. Taking place at the eSports Arena in Santa Ana, California, Liberation X battled through three days of matches, ending up in a showdown on the final day against Nemesis Hydra. Eventually Liberation X would defeat Nemesis Hydra and take home a cool $10,000.

Find the missing expedition in Tibet before the Nazis in Lost Horizon, now out on Google Play

As we mentioned last month Lost Horizon is now out for Android. Released by Animation Arts and Deep Silver FISHLABS, Lost Horizon is a point-and-click adventure game that takes place in Tibet during 1936. Players will assume the role of a pilot named Fenton Paddock, who is offered the chance to track down an exposition that ended in mystery somewhere in the highlands of Tibet.
